The Vatican

The world’s smallest state is also one of its most attraction-packed spots. As the center of the Catholic Church, Vatican City is full of breathtaking religious architecture and artistic treasures. Must-sees include the imposing St. Peter’s Basilica—so vast that the Statue of Liberty could fit comfortably under its dome—and the mesmerizing frescoes at the Sistine Chapel.
